Why the Right Tool Matters for Modern Web Projects

If you pick a tool that ignores the needs of Responsive Web Design, you’ll spend extra hours fixing breakpoints later. A solid tool should let you set fluid breakpoints, preview layouts on multiple viewports, and export CSS that respects CSS Grid rules. That’s why many designers pair visual editors with a utility framework like Tailwind CSS – the framework translates design tokens directly into class names, cutting down on custom stylesheet bloat. Collaboration is another hidden cost; teams using Figma report fewer version‑control headaches because comments live on the design itself and developers can copy CSS snippets straight from the interface. In practice, the workflow looks like this: you start a new project in a design tool, set up a responsive grid, drop in components, and then hand off a style guide that already references Tailwind utilities.
